The growth of the infrastructure industry in India has fuelled a healthy demand for pre-engineered buildings (PEB). PEB buildings are pre-fabricated steel frames or beams designed and manufactured in the factory of the PEB supplier; and eventually assembled at the site of construction. The steel structures or beams are formed by welding steel plates together. These are then bolted together to form the entire frame of the prefabricated metal buildings.

This new technology is quite prevalent in the west. However, PEB in India has also caught on and is well on the way becoming a standard in Indian constructions; and growing at 30%. A metal roof is made from metal piece, or tiles; and can be applied over an existing roof. The same material used for metal roofs can be used for siding as well. 4. 75% of heat enters a house from the roof and only 25% from the walls due to direct and longest exposure to solar radiation. This heat is absorbed by the roof and the house ceiling that causes the temperature to rise within the house. Consequently, air-conditioning is required to cool down the living space. Metal roofs reflect heat effectively, thus minimizing heat of absorption.  TRACDEK roof systems can be effectively used in combination for optimal thermal characteristics, leading to lowering of air conditioning costs.

Interarch Delivers Fabrication and Assembly Shops at JCB's Jaipur Plant

http://www.interarchbuildings.com
Interarch, one of the leading turnkey pre-engineered steel construction solution provider, has executed a fabrication shop and an assembly shop for JCB India's Jaipur plant. In 2014 Interarch designed manufacturing and delivered a fabrication shop and assembly shop for JCB India Ltd. in Jaipur. The buildings are spread over the area of 30400 sq. m. and 22800 sq. m. respectively.

The project is designed according to the latest IS design codes IS 800: working stress design for both the buildings with consideration given to all the geographical data like wind velocity, seismic zone as per IS standard for every particular site. The lateral forces resulting from the seismic or wind loads are resisted by diagonal branching and jack portals at intermediate column locations. The design of the building was such that temperature was kept in control for monitoring the thermal expansion and contraction.

The expertise of Interarch design department reduced the engineering time of the fabrication shop and assembly shop which was very complex and new innovation has been done to design the building. Interarch bearing heavy load of approximately 225 metres hanging from the roof and for the column grid of 40*24 metres. Higher grade of 450 MPa steel has been used for the built up members.

Interarch had to deploy innovative solutions like highest safety standard which were followed in line with the international standard to achieve zero accident, logistics and warehousing control at site to meet site standard norms. Daily tool box meeting to review the site status and way forward was done, regular quality check jointly measures to achieve best quality in line with global standard were taken.

The project was completed within a period of 6 months. JCB India Ltd. India,s largest manufacturer of construction equipment is a fully-owned subsidiary of JCB Bamford Excavators Ltd. UK.
